
BODY.main
{
	background: url(img/left_bg.gif) repeat-y;
}


TD
{
	font-family: Arial CE, Helvetica CE, Arial, Helvetica, sans-serif;
	font-size: 12px;
}

.copyright
{
	font-size: 10px;
	color: #668;
}

.bannerbg
{
	background: #d0d0c0;
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
	color: black;
}
.bannerlogo
{
	background: #ffffff;
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
}

.toplinks
{
	background: #003399;
	font-family: Arial, Verdana;
	font-size: 10px;
	font-weight: bold;
	color: #f0f0f0;
	padding-left: 10px;
}
.toplinks A,
.toplinks A:visited,
.toplinks A:hover
{
	color: white;
	text-decoration: none;
}
.toplinks A:hover
{
	color: Yellow;
	text-decoration: none;
}

.topline { width:780px; height: 1px; margin:0; padding:0; background: #226072; }
.topline2 { width:780px; height: 1px; margin:0; padding:0; background: #184350; }
.topline3 { width:780px; height: 1px; margin:0; padding:0; background: #F5F5F5; }
.topline4 { width:780px; height: 1px; margin:0; padding:0; background: #8F8F51; }
.topline5 { width:780px; height: 1px; margin:0; padding:0; background: black; }

.mainlogo
{
	background: #ffffff;
	font-family: Arial;
	font-size: 10px;
	
}

.topquicklinks
{
	background: #2C72BB;
	background: #ff7200;
	font-family: Verdana;
	font-size: 10px;
	color: white;
	padding-left: 10px;
}
.topquicklinks A,
.topquicklinks A:visited,
.topquicklinks A:hover
{
	font-weight: bold;
	color: white;
	text-decoration: none;
}
.topquicklinks A:hover
{
	text-decoration: underline;
}

.topminibar
{
	background: #CBCE9A;
	color: #93631D;
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
	padding-left: 10px;
}

.leftmain
{
	width: 142px;


}

.rightmain
{
	width: 142px;
	background: url(img/right_bg.gif) repeat-y;
}

.telo
{
	width: 475px;
	padding: 10px 10px 10px 10px;
	margin: 0px;
	font-family: Arial;
	font-size: 12px;
}

.leftmenu
{
	background: white;
	font-family: Arial;
	font-size: 11px;
	padding: 4px;
	padding-left: 6px;
}

.leftmenu A,
.leftmenu A:visited,
.leftmenu A:hover
{
	text-decoration: none;
	color: #4040f5;
}
.leftmenu A:hover
{
	text-decoration: underline;
	color: black;
}


.leftmenubar
{
	background: #F79273;
	background: #FF0000;
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
	color: white;
	padding-left: 6px;
}
.leftmenubar A,
.leftmenubar A:visited,
.leftmenubar A:hover
{
	color: white;
	text-decoration: none;
}
.leftmenubar A:hover
{
	text-decoration: underline;
}

.leftmenuline
{
	width: 139px;
	height: 2px;
	background: white;
}


.rightmenu
{
	width:139px;
	background: white;
	font-family: Arial;
	font-size: 11px;
	padding: 4px;
	padding-left: 6px;
}

.rightmenu A,
.rightmenu A:visited,
.rightmenu A:hover
{
	text-decoration: none;
	color: #4F63D5;
}
.rightmenu A:hover
{
	text-decoration: underline;
	color: black;
}


.rightmenubar
{
	background: #5FB867;
	background: green;
	font-family: Verdana;
	font-size: 10px;
	font-weight: bold;
	color: white;
	padding-left: 6px;
}
.rightmenubar A,
.rightmenubar A:visited,
.rightmenubar A:hover
{
	color: white;
	text-decoration: none;
}
.rightmenubar A:hover
{
	text-decoration: underline;
}

.rightmenuline
{
	width: 139px;
	height: 2px;
	background: white;
}

.reklama
{
	font-family: Verdana, Arial CE, Arial, sans-serif;
	font-weight: bold;
	font-size: 10px;
}

.smallinput
{
	width: 110px;
	background: white;
	font-family: Arial CE, Arial, sans-serif;
	font-size: 11px;
}

.clanek
{
	background: white;
}

.claneknadpis
{
	font-family: Arial;
	font-size: 18px;
}

.clanekanotace
{
	color: #055;
}

.clanek H1
{
	font-size: 18px;
	font-weight: normal;
}


.clanek H2
{
	font-size: 15px;
	font-weight: bold;
}

.seznamclanku A,
.seznamclanku A:visited,
.seznamclanku A:hover
{
	color: #006;
	font-size: 13px;
	text-decoration: none;
}
.seznamclanku A:hover
{
	text-decoration: underline;
}

.archivclanku A,
.archivclanku A:visited,
.archivclanku A:hover
{
	color: blue;
	font-size: 13px;
	text-decoration: none;
}
.archivclanku A:hover
{
	text-decoration: underline;
}

.magazinheader
{
	padding: 5px;
	background: #d0e0f0;
}
.magazinheader A,
.magazinheader A:visited,
.magazinheader A:hover
{
	color: blue;
}
.magazinheader A:hover
{
	text-decoration: none;
}

A,
A:hover
A:visited
{
	text-decoration: none;
	color: blue;
}
A:hover
{
	text-decoration: underline;
}

.ablack
{
	color: red;
}

.katalogsekce,
.katalogsekce A,
.katalogsekce A:hover,
.katalogsekce A:visited
{
	color: #119;
	font-family: MS Sans serif, Arial CE, Helvetica CE,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.katalogsekce A:hover
{
	text-decoration: underline;
	color: #d50;
}
.katalogsekce
{
	color: black;
}

.katalognadpis
{
	font-family: Arial CE, Helvetica CE,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-weight: bold;
	width: 100%;
	border: 1px solid;
	background: #eee;
	margin: 5 0 5 0;
	padding: 2 0 2 10;
	color: #803;
	vertical-align: middle;
}
.katalognadpis A,
.katalognadpis A:hover,
.katalognadpis A:visited
{
	text-decoration: none;
	color: #803;
}

.katalogpopis
{
	font-family: Arial, MS Sans serif, Arial CE, Helvetica CE,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

.katalogup
{
	vertical-align: middle;
	margin-left: 10px;

}	

.katalogkategorie
{
	font-family: Tahoma, Verdana;
	font-size: 11px;
	border: 2px inset;
	background: #ffe;
	padding: 5 0 7 5;
}
.katalogkategorie A
{
	color: #00a;
}
.katalogkategorie TD
{
	font-family: Tahoma, Verdana;
	font-size: 11px;
}

.katalogbrief
{
	padding-top: 5px;
	font-size: 10px;
	text-align: justify;
}
.katalogbrief A.header
{
	font-size: 12px;
	font-weight: bold;
	color: #02b;
}
.katalogbriefcena
{
	font-size: 12px;
	color: #604;
}

.katalogstranky,
{
	background: #eee;
	sborder-top: 1px solid;
	padding: 5px;
	border-bottom: 1px solid;
	text-align: right;
	width: 100%;
	margin: 10 0 0 0;
	font-family: MS Sans serif;
}
.katalogstranky A
{
	color: #00d;
}

.zbozitop
{
	border: 1px solid;
	border-color: #f44;
}

.zbozinazev1
{
	font-size: 11px;
	padding: 1 1 1 10;
	background: #f44;
	color: white;
}

.zbozinazev
{
	font-family: Tahoma;
	font-size: 11px;
	padding: 3 3 3 10;
	background: #fff0d0;
}
.zbozinazev A,
.zbozinazev A:visited
{
	text-decoration: none;
	color: #006;
}
.zbozinazev A:hover
{
	text-decoration: underline;
	color: blue;
}


.zboziactions
{
	width: 100%;
	text-align: right;
	vertical-align: middle;
	padding: 8 0 8 0;
}
.zbozipopis
{
	padding-left: 10px;
	font-family: Tahoma;
	font-size: 11px;
}

.textpolenormalni
{
	background: #fdfaee;
	padding: 1px;
	width: 100%;
	font-family: Tahoma;
	font-size: 11px;
}

.window
{
	padding: 10px;
	width: 100%;
	font-family: MS sans serif;
	font-size: 11px;
}

H4.window
{
	sfont-family: Verdana;
	sfont-size: 13px;
	margin-top: 0;
	margin-bottom: 0;
	width: 100%;
	background: #44d;
	color: white;
}

.button
{
	background: #eee;
	font-family: MS sans serif;
	font-size: 12px;
	border: 1px outset;
	height: 22px;
	width: 100px;
}

.tahoma
{
	font-family: Tahoma;
	font-size: 11px;
}

.arial
{
	font-family: Arial;
	font-size: 12px;
}


.ramecek
{
	border: 1px solid;
	background: #eee;
	padding: 8px;
}


.firmabrief
{
	width: 475px;
	margin: 8 0 5 0;
	padding: 1 10 1 10;
}


.firmabrieframecek
{
	width: 475px;
	margin: 13 0 13 0;
	padding: 1 10 1 10;
	border-top: 1px solid #ddd;
	border-bottom: 1px solid #ddd;
	sborder: 1px solid #ddd;
}

.odkazbrief
{
	width: 475px;
	margin: 8 0 5 0;
	padding: 1 10 1 10;
}

.odkazodkaz A,
.odkazodkaz A:visited,
.odkazodkaz A:hover
{
	text-decoration: none;
	color: #03a;
}
.odkazodkaz A:hover
{
	text-decoration: underline;
	color: blue;
}

.clankystranky
{
	border-top: 1px solid #ddd;
	border-bottom: 1px solid #ddd;
	font-family: MS sans serif,Arial,Tahoma;
	font-size: 11px;
} 

.lodenazev
{
	width: 100%;
	spadding: 2 5 2 5;
	sbackground: #006;
	scolor: white;
	font-family: Arial;
	font-size: 16px;
	font-weight: bold;
}
.lodebrief
{
	font-family: Arial;
	font-size: 11px;
	background: #f2f2ff;
}
.lodebriefg
{
	font-family: Arial;
	font-size: 10px;
	background: #f2f2ff;
	color: #449;
}
.lodebriefh
{
	font-family: Arial;
	font-size: 10px;
	background: #dde;
	color: #668;
	padding: 1 1 1 5;
}

.kurzlistek
{
	padding-right: 3px;
	font-family: Tahoma;
	font-size: 10px;
}
